are they easy to fold down when not in use? and easy to move around the garden? :)
 
are they easy to fold down when not in use? and easy to move around the garden? :)

In a word, no! Well not IMO!! If you try and move it on your own you will twist the (not very strong) hinges & they will soon snap. The construction is clever but I personally wouldn't buy another. I find it much easier to simply drag the one we made ourselves (also 6ftxft). I like the idea of a folding run but the reality of the one I bought (same as the one on the link) is that the quality isn't great :(
 
I don't have any problem with it. It folds easily but is a little bit awkward to put up by yourself but I manage. It is heavy though to lift alone but again I manage. I keep it folded up propped against the fence when I'm not using it
